#[non_exhaustive]pub struct ExportResult {
    pub export_metadata: ExportMetadata,
    pub file_metadata: FileMetadata,
}Available on crate features 
sync_routes and dbx_files only.Fields (Non-exhaustive)§
This struct is marked as non-exhaustive
Non-exhaustive structs could have additional fields added in future. Therefore, non-exhaustive structs cannot be constructed in external crates using the traditional 
Struct { .. } syntax; cannot be matched against without a wildcard ..; and struct update syntax will not work.export_metadata: ExportMetadataMetadata for the exported version of the file.
file_metadata: FileMetadataMetadata for the original file.
Implementations§
Source§impl ExportResult
 
impl ExportResult
pub fn new(export_metadata: ExportMetadata, file_metadata: FileMetadata) -> Self
Trait Implementations§
Source§impl Clone for ExportResult
 
impl Clone for ExportResult
Source§fn clone(&self) -> ExportResult
 
fn clone(&self) -> ExportResult
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
 
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from 
source. Read moreSource§impl Debug for ExportResult
 
impl Debug for ExportResult
Source§impl<'de> Deserialize<'de> for ExportResult
 
impl<'de> Deserialize<'de> for ExportResult
Source§fn deserialize<D: Deserializer<'de>>(deserializer: D) -> Result<Self, D::Error>
 
fn deserialize<D: Deserializer<'de>>(deserializer: D) -> Result<Self, D::Error>
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for ExportResult
 
impl PartialEq for ExportResult
Source§impl Serialize for ExportResult
 
impl Serialize for ExportResult
impl StructuralPartialEq for ExportResult
Auto Trait Implementations§
impl Freeze for ExportResult
impl RefUnwindSafe for ExportResult
impl Send for ExportResult
impl Sync for ExportResult
impl Unpin for ExportResult
impl UnwindSafe for ExportResult
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
    T: ?Sized,
 
impl<T> BorrowMut<T> for Twhere
    T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
 
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more